Concrete Slab Cutting in Corpus Christi, TX
Concrete slab cutting services involve precisely creating openings, joints, or sections within existing concrete slabs to accommodate various construction or renovation needs. This service is commonly used for installing utilities such as plumbing, electrical conduits, or HVAC systems, as well as for creating access points like doors, windows, or expansion joints. Property owners often request slab cutting for projects like basement renovations, garage modifications, or the installation of new flooring, ensuring that the concrete is cut accurately without damaging surrounding areas.
Before requesting concrete slab cutting, property owners should consider the location and thickness of the existing slab, as well as any embedded utilities or reinforcement materials. Understanding the scope of the project, including the size and number of cuts needed, helps ensure that the work is completed efficiently and safely. Proper planning can prevent potential issues such as cracks or damage to the slab, making it important to communicate these details when consulting with a service provider.
